AI 编码体验,能提升多少效率?这款 IDE 的新功能,值得期待吗?

2025-10-21 10:15:02 作者:Vali编辑部

Cursor 0.50版本的更新堪称一次全方位升级。从计费机制到后台协作,从代码理解到多项目管理,每个细节都体现出对开发者需求的精准把握。这次迭代不仅让工具更智能,还让工作流程更顺畅。对于需要AI辅助编程的用户来说,这次更新相当于给日常工作装上了更高效的加速器。

一、计费机制:直击痛点,简单明了

0.5版本对计费系统进行了重构,彻底告别了以往复杂的计费模式。现在用户可以清晰看到每笔费用的构成,无需再为隐藏的计费项担心。Normal模式采用按请求计费,每次AI交互都算作一个请求,适合日常开发使用。Max Mode则按token计费,覆盖输入输出、文件读取等所有操作,适合处理复杂任务。Pro版本每月提供500个请求额度,日常使用Normal模式,遇到难点再切换Max Mode,既经济又灵活。

二、Max Mode全面开放,性能提升显著

Max Mode的全面开放让Cursor的性能达到新高度。最大支持1M tokens的上下文窗口,足以容纳中型项目的全部核心代码。10K tokens可处理小型工具库,200K tokens覆盖完整Web框架,1M tokens直接应对大型框架核心。工具调用次数提升至200次,复杂分析生成轻松应对。文件读取功能增强,read_file工具一次可读取750行代码。Claude 3系列、GPT-4系列、Gemini 2.5 Pro等主流模型均支持,用户只需在模型选择器中一键开启。项目初次分析时启用Max Mode,配合@folders命令,全局代码理解变得简单。

三、后台Agent:AI协作的范式革新

后台Agent的加入让Cursor的协作能力实现质的飞跃。这项功能能在远程虚拟机(macOS和Linux)上异步执行复杂任务,多个Agent可并行处理。任务完成后自动提交PR或发送通知,无需人工值守。这种模式类似Devin的运作方式,适用于修复小bug、构建新功能、代码重构、生成文档等场景。目前仅在Max Mode下可用,已集成GitHub。官方表示这只是开始,未来将扩展更多功能,想象空间巨大。

四、上下文与编辑体验:效率提升明显

日常编码体验得到显著优化。代码库上下文改进后,@folders命令能将整个代码库纳入上下文。用户需在设置中开启"完整文件夹内容"选项,上下文标签新增小图标提示文件是否被包含。内联编辑界面焕新,新增"完整文件编辑"和"发送给Agent"功能。前者无需Agent即可修改整个文件,后者可将选中代码块交给Agent处理跨文件修改或复杂任务。长文件编辑速度提升,Agent新增搜索替换工具,处理长文件效率提高近一倍。Postgres代码库测试显示,处理速度提升明显。目前仅支持Anthropic模型,后续将扩展。

五、聊天功能优化:实用性强

聊天功能的改进让交互更便捷。用户现在可直接导出聊天记录为Markdown文件,文本和代码块都能保存。复制聊天对话功能允许从任意消息开始新对话,保留原记录。这个功能对需要多分支探索的开发者来说非常实用。官方表示这是刚需功能,实际使用中确实能提升工作效率。

六、其他改进:细节之处见用心

Agent现在使用原生终端模拟,体验更流畅。@folders命令会自动包含所有可纳入上下文的文件,智能程度提升。聊天上下文状态新增图标显示文件是否被包含或压缩。MCP工具可单独禁用,增加控制权限。Claude 3 Opus的免费使用次数调整,用户需珍惜每日10次的额度。

七、总结:工具进化,开发者受益

Cursor 0.50的更新让AI辅助编程工具更上一层楼。后台Agent和Max Mode的升级,显著提升了处理大型项目的能力。虽然成本有所增加,但带来的效率提升和功能扩展值得肯定。AI原生IDE的发展方向越来越清晰,Cursor正朝着更智能、更自动化的方向迈进。对于追求高效工作的开发者来说,这次更新是不容错过的升级机会。